Clients and Creative Control | Kevin Boss
kevinboss.net
It’s happened to us all at one point. You toil over the design of your newest website project, cross all your t’s and dot all your i’s and finally complete that mockup for submission to the client. The client is overjoyed! You hit it right on! Oh but wait, he’d like a small change. He has this cute little animated gif of a butterfly that he thinks would look perfect right next to his horizontal menu. Oh and that nice neutral color you chose, he wants it bright yellow.

A systematic approach to the development of research-based web design guidelines for older people
www.springerlink.com
"This paper presents a systematic approach to the development of a set of research-based ageing-centred web design guidelines (SilverWeb Guidelines). The approach included an initial extensive literature review in the area of human–computer interaction and ageing, the development of an initial set of guidelines based on the reviewed literature, a card sorting exercise for their classification, an affinity diagramming exercise for the reduction and further finalisation of the guidelines, and finally a set of heuristic evaluations for the validation and test of robustness of the guidelines. The 38 final guidelines are grouped into eleven distinct categories (target design, use of graphics, navigation, browser window features, content layout design, links, user cognitive design, use of colour and background, text design, search engine, user feedback and support)."
